3 NOTES:
4 1 The VENDOR shall complete this data sheet, and provide all information as built.
5 2 Minimum instrumentation required for safe operation of the pump package shall be furnished by the VENDOR.
8 5 Pump minimum flow requirement to be advised by VENDOR.
10 7 The engine rating shall be suitable for end of curve operation of the pump excluding Site ISO Power Derating.
11 8 No equipment, junction box or their supporting structure shall overhang the base plate.
12 9 The VENDOR shall furnish a pump with NPSHR less than NPSHA by at least 1m at rated flow and min.0.5mtr at 150% rated flow.
15 11 The pump material selection shall be as per the requirement of latest Edition of NFPA 20 .
16 12 Pumps shall comply with the requirement of NFPA 20 and shall be UL/FM certified.
17 13 Each pump shall be provided with control panel which will be located in field close to the pump. Also the engine controls shall be included
18 in the same panel.
19 14 Diesel day tank and interconnecting piping between the diesel day tank and engine shal be in the VENDOR,s scope of supply.
20 15 The VENDOR shall clearly mention power supply requirement for control panel / batteries.
21 16 The VENDOR to supply circulation valve and set below the shutoff pressure at minimum expected shut off pressure. The valve shall
22 provide flow of sufficient water to prevent the pump from overheating when operating with no discharge.Pump casing shall be supplied
23 with integral Air Release valve; Suction (compound type) & Disch. Pressure Gauges (Glycerine filled type) with isolation cocks
24 per NFPA 20 std.
25 17 Engine Power shall be selected per latest NFP-20 Std. Vendor shall submit with his offer a detailed power calculations for the
26 Site maximum Ambient temperature derated conditions, excluding all self consumption for engine Auxiliaries & other losses
27 (per SAE Std. J1349 / ISO-3046-1). Net Power available to the Pump shaft shall be min 110% of the max. Hydraulic Power demand
28 of the Fire pump proposed performance curves data. Complete Engine Mfr. Technical catalogues with specific vendor selected
29 Engine model details also shall be submitted for review along with bid.
30 18 Engine speed selection shall be restricted <1800rpm with max. Mean Piston speed of < 8m/s for reliable intermittent start / stop of pump
31 against pressurised Fire water ring mains service conditions required. This shall be confirmed by VENDOR.
32 19 Engine to Pump Direct Coupling shall be with a min.SFof 1.75
35 21 The Engine Skid shall be integral with a closed circuit air cooled Heat Exchanger , including expansion tank with a thermostatically
36 controlled built in engine jacket water heater arrangement. Diesel Engine skid shall be UL Listed and FM approved.
37
38 22 Pumps shall not furnish less than 150% of rated capacity at not less than 65% of total rated head.(excluding additional water
39 flow to Engine cooling auxillaries from fire pump discharge).
